Dual Conversion Path Layout
The primary call to action, "Check Your Date" in antique gold, appears as a floating button after the header and anchors at the bottom of every third section. A secondary path, "Download the Planning Guide," captures email addresses from couples who are not yet ready to inquire. Both paths are pre-positioned so no layout work is needed.
Soft Gradient Color System
Colors do not sit in hard containers. Deep plum, dusty mauve, warm champagne, and antique gold layer and bleed across panels through soft gradients. The effect mirrors watercolor bleeding on wet paper, giving the page a cohesive painterly quality that reinforces the venue's natural setting.
Mood-Driven Lighting Progression
The photo treatment across sections follows the arc of a real wedding day. Images shift from afternoon gold light in the early sections to candlelit amber in the later ones. This pulls the visitor emotionally through a full evening, making the venue feel lived-in and real before they ever visit.

Design & branding system
The Plum Executive color system was chosen to feel like a late-summer evening at a stone-and-timber estate. Every color has a physical reference point rooted in the venue's real environment.
- Deep plum (#4A2040) grounds the page like velvet draped over a farmhouse table; dusty mauve (#B8889C) washes across gradient panels like the blush of a late sunset
- Warm champagne (#F2E6D9) creates breathing room the way candlelight softens a tent ceiling; antique gold (#C9A84C) traces interactive elements like the thin rim of a toasting flute
- Typography uses thin champagne-toned serif for the venue name reveal and floating italic captions over each scene image; no hard borders or sharp containers appear anywhere on the page

How this template helps you convert
The page is designed around a single principle: earn the click by making the visitor feel their own wedding happening here before asking for any action. Conversion is built into the structure, not bolted on at the end.
- The video header and mood-driven photo progression create an emotional investment early. By the time a couple reaches the first call to action, they are already imagining the day, which lowers the barrier to clicking "Check Your Date."
- Two conversion paths serve two different readiness levels. Couples ready to inquire go straight to the interactive availability calendar. Couples still in the research phase download the planning guide, giving the venue a warm email lead to follow up with.
